Chemistry
IUPAC Name: Adamantan-2-one
Synonyms of 2-Adamantanone (CAS NO.700-58-3): 2-Adamantone ; 2-Oxoadamantane ; Adamantanone ; Tricyclo(3.3.1.13,7)decan-2-one ; Tricyclo(3.3.1.13,7)decanone (9CI)
CAS NO: 700-58-3
Molecular Formula: C10H14O
Molecular Weight: 150.22
Molecular Structure: 
EINECS: 211-847-2
H bond acceptors: 1
H bond donors: 0
Freely Rotating Bonds: 0
Polar Surface Area: 17.07 Å2
Index of Refraction: 1.535
Molar Refractivity: 42.35 cm3
Molar Volume: 135.9 cm3
Surface Tension: 38.6 dyne/cm
Density: 1.105 g/cm3
Flash Point: 95.7 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 48.39 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 246.7 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.0267 mmHg at 25°C
Melting Point: 256-258 °C (subl.)(lit.)
Solubility: methanol: 0.1 g/mL, clear
Appearance: white to off-white crystalline powder

Toxicity Data With Reference
| Organism | Test Type | Route | Reported Dose (Normalized Dose) | Effect |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| mouse | LD50 | intraperitoneal | 780mg/kg (780mg/kg) | Pharmaceutical Chemistry Journal Vol. 10, Pg. 454, 1976. |
Safety Profile
Safety Information about 2-Adamantanone (CAS NO.700-58-3):
Hazard Codes:
Xi
Risk Statements: 52-36/37/38
R36/37/38: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in.
R52: Harmful to aquatic organisms.
Safety Statements: 22-24/25-36-26
S22: Do not breathe dust.
S24/25: Avoid contact with skin and eyes.
S26: In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ice.
S36: Wear suitable protective clothing.
WGK Germany: 2
RTECS: AU5018000
Hazard Note: Irritant
HS Code: 29142900
Specification
General Information: As in any fire, wear a self-contained breathing apparatus in pressure-demand, MSHA/NIOSH (approved or equivalent), and full protective gear.
Extinguishing Media: Use water spray, dry chemical, carbon dioxide, or chemical foam.
Handling: Avoid breathing dust, vapor, mist, or gas. Avoid contact with skin and eyes. Avoid ingestion and inhalation.
Storage: Store in a cool, dry place. Store in a tightly closed container.
